Amaya project is intended to be a comprehensive client environment for testing and evaluating new proposals for Web standards and formats.

A large part of the intended features of Amaya are implemented in this release, but some of them are not complete yet.

Here are some key features of "Amaya":
Amaya lets users both browse and author Web pages

Using Amaya you can create Web pages and upload them onto a server. Authors can create a document from scratch, they can browse the web and find the information they need, copy and paste it to their pages, and create links to other Web sites. All this is done in a straightforward and simple manner, and actions are performed in a single consistent environment. Editing and browsing functions are integrated seamlessly in a single tool.

Amaya maintains a consistent internal document model adhering to the DTD

Amaya always represents the document internally in a structured way consistent with the Document Type Definition (DTD). A properly structured document enables other tools to further process the data safely.
Amaya allows you to display the document structure at the same time as the formatted view, which is portrayed diagrammatically on the screen.

Amaya is able to work on several documents at a time

Several (X)HTML, native MathML (.mml) and SVG (.svg) documents can be displayed and edited at a time.

Amaya helps authors create hypertext links

The editor helps you create and text out links to other documents on the Web from the document you currently are working on. You can view the links and get a feel for how the information is interconnected. This feature is not limited to HTML anchors. With XLink, any MathML and SVG element can be a link too.

Amaya includes a collaborative annotation application

Annotations are external comments, notes, remarks that can be attached to any Web document or a selected part of the document. This application is based on Resource Description Framework (RDF), XLink, and XPointer recommendations.

Amaya is easily extended.

Several APIs and mechanisms are available to change and extend its functionality with the least modification to the source code.

What's New in This Release:
New features
A new button to open the CSS editor which replaces style panels
A new file explorer panel
A large set of new mathematical constructions in the Maths panel (thanks to Frederic Wang)
New Maths shortcuts (thanks to Frederic Wang)

Bug fixes
Amaya crashed when new list-style-position and list-style-type CSS properties are added
On Windows platforms, Amaya 8.52 crashed when a help page is open
On Windows, the selection in the pull-down of Open document dialog generated an empty selection
On Linux platforms, the copy/paste between applications was not correctly supported
Change the communication method between Amaya instances
When a New document command is aborted, the next Open document was interpreted as a document creation
Amaya now accepts to insert tab characters in text files
When the last row or the last tbody is deleted, Amaya now deletes the table
Amaya had problems when creating a span that contains a span inside it
Amaya didn't allow one to make any link containing only an image
Amaya refused to create an Information Type element (e.g. ) within an empty
When a element is cut then pasted, its "xmlns" attribute was lost
Changing the doctype in a new created document, before writing any character in it, removed the body
Amaya now removes broken elements when saving
No XML declaration and are generated when the charset is unknown
Sometimes Amaya generated the MathML entity instead of the HTML entity, or the HTML entity instead of the MathML entity
Avoid to insert a newline within the content of an RCS instruction
Apply class doesn't add the class name if it is already present
Amaya didn't interpret correctly a border property without color value
Amaya didn't display background images attached to table cells
Fixing formatting bugs and crashes
Improving the management of spaces when the option "Keep multiple spaces" is set
Always keep spaces and lines within PI (useful for php files)
With large documents, the view was not updated after a Ctrl Home command
When a large document element is selected, pressing the down(up)-arrow key generated a scroll line by line until the bottom (top) of the element instead of a skip
